- W2765112975 abstract "Abstract.DIFFERENCES IN BURNOUT ACCORDING TO SEX AND AGE IN NON-UNIVERSITY TEACHERSMaslach's three-factor model, burnout model more used for research on teacher issues, describes three types of symptoms, emotional exhaustion involving physical and mental fatigue, depersonalization with negative feelings, and a feeling of low achievement that translates to think that the demands surpass the resources to be attended effectively. As a consequence of this, generalized discouragement occurs in those who suffer from it. The objective of the present study was to analyze differences in burnout according to sex and age. To this end, 507 participants were recruited, who provided teaching in Early Childhood Education, Primary Education and Secondary Education. Participants completed the Maslasch Burnout Inventory. The results of the analysis of variance showed statistically significant differences according to sex and age groups. These findings show the importance of implementing programs aimed at the prevention of symptoms.Key words: burnout, teaching staff, emotional exhaustion, personal fulfillment, depersonalization.Resumen.El modelo de burnout más utilizado en los estudios sobre el profesorado, es el modelo trifactorial de Maslach, que describe tres tipos de síntomas, agotamiento emocional que conlleva cansancio físico y mental, despersonalización con sentimientos negativos, y sensación de bajo logro profesional que se traduce al pensar que las demandas superan los recursos para ser atendidas eficazmente. Como consecuencia del mismo se produce, en quienes lo padecen, un desánimo generalizado. El objetivo del presente estudio fue analizar las diferencias en burnout según el sexo y la edad. Para ello se reclutó una muestra 507 participantes, que impartían docencia en Educación Infantil, Educación Primaria y Educación Secundaria. Los participantes cumplimentaron el Maslasch Burnout Inventory. Los resultados de los análisis de varianza concretaron diferencias estadísticamente significativas tanto en función del sexo como de los grupos de edad. Estos hallazgos muestran la importancia de implementar programas orientados a la prevención de los síntomas.Palabras clave: burnout, profesorado, agotamiento emocional, realización personal, despersonalización." @default.
